  • I agree 6th st is over-rated. Notch below New Orleans Bourbon Street feel, and later at night not that safe, really. For hanging out after the show either stay in the bars neat UT area or go to South Congress (called "SoCo") or what is known as the west 6th St area.

    I agree that Hotel San Jose and Hotel St Celilia are one of a kind. For A+ location with B quality and price hotel, the Raddison on Town Lake is perfect. The Double Tree Guest Suites is probably closet to the venue.

    Oh yeah, forgot great bar scene on Rainey St east of downtown.
